I have another kiln opening for you. This load included pieces made with Plainsman 340S Speckled Clay. I chose to use a slow cool firing schedule with the high temperature set to 2190 degrees and held for 5 mins. I wanted to make sure the speckled clay would not bloat. There are also pieces that are fully glazed with celadons. This firing schedule ensures that I get very few pinholes.

Hey Mary! I have also used the cherry Blossom on white clay. I really like it, but I have always been a fan of a ballet pink. The combo on the planter is 2x birch and then 2x Norse over with a 2x band of light flux. Although, I have reversed the application, and it still turns out nice, AND I have used 3 and 3 coats, too. It also looks great on dark clay. OK, thanks for saying you would like a vid on those two pieces. Also, thank you so much for your kind compliments. I am thrilled you like to watch my vids.
